London Spy London Spy is a British-American five-part drama television serial created and written by Tom Rob Smith that aired on BBC Two from 9 November until 7 December 2015. [1] [2] It was aired on Netflix in 2018. Plot

However, the key reason that "London Spy" is part of this list is because at the heart of the series is a love story between two men, Alex and Danny. Furthermore, Danny's older friend, Scotty (Jim Broadbent), provides an insight into the days when being gay was not only illegal in the UK but actually was viewed as a disgrace within MI6.

December 8, 2015 Spoilers for London Spy episode 1 below. Danny (Ben Whishaw) - a young man enjoying a hedonistic lifestyle on London's gay scene - exits a nightclub into the cold light of dawn coming down hard. Alone and bereft standing on Lambeth Bridge, only a chance encounter with a jogger pulls him back from the brink.
